Technique Tip for This Recipe
To achieve the fluffiest pancakes, make sure not to overmix the batter. Stir until the ingredients are just combined; a few lumps are perfectly fine. Overmixing can result in dense pancakes instead of light and airy ones.

Alternative Ingredients
all-purpose flour - Substitute with whole wheat flour: Whole wheat flour adds more fiber and nutrients, though it may make the pancakes slightly denser.
sugar - Substitute with maple syrup: Maple syrup provides a natural sweetness and adds a rich flavor to the pancakes.
baking powder - Substitute with baking soda and lemon juice: Use ¼ teaspoon of baking soda and ½ teaspoon of lemon juice to create the same leavening effect.
salt - Substitute with sea salt: Sea salt can be used in the same quantity and provides a slightly different mineral profile.
almond milk - Substitute with oat milk: Oat milk has a creamy texture and mild flavor, making it a great alternative for vegan pancakes.
vegetable oil - Substitute with coconut oil: Coconut oil adds a subtle coconut flavor and is a healthy fat option.
vanilla extract - Substitute with almond extract: Almond extract gives a different but pleasant nutty flavor to the pancakes.

How to Store or Freeze Your Pancakes
Allow the pancakes to cool completely on a wire rack before storing. This prevents them from becoming soggy due to trapped steam.
For short-term storage, place the cooled pancakes in an airtight container or a resealable plastic bag. Store them in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
To freeze, lay the pancakes in a single layer on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Freeze for about 1-2 hours, or until they are solid. This prevents them from sticking together.
Once frozen, transfer the pancakes to a freezer-safe bag or container. Label with the date and store in the freezer for up to 2 months.
When ready to enjoy, reheat the pancakes directly from the freezer. You can use a microwave, toaster, or oven. For the microwave, heat on high for about 20-30 seconds per pancake. In the toaster, use a low setting to avoid burning. For the oven, preheat to 350°F (175°C) and bake for about 10 minutes.
If you prefer a crispier texture, reheat the pancakes in a skillet over medium heat for a few minutes on each side until warmed through.
For added flavor, consider brushing the pancakes with a bit of maple syrup or vegan butter before reheating. This can enhance their taste and give them a delightful glaze.
Always check the pancakes for any signs of spoilage before consuming, especially if they have been stored for an extended period.

Vegan Pancakes Recipe
Ingredients
Pancake Batter
- 1 cup All-purpose flour
- 2 tablespoon Sugar
- 1 tablespoon Baking powder
- ⅛ teaspoon Salt
- 1 cup Almond milk
- 2 tablespoon Vegetable oil
- 1 teaspoon Vanilla extract
Instructions
- In a mixing bowl, whisk together the flour, sugar, baking powder, and salt.
- Add the almond milk, vegetable oil, and vanilla extract. Stir until just combined.
- Heat a non-stick pan over medium heat. Pour ¼ cup of batter onto the pan for each pancake.
- Cook until bubbles form on the surface, then flip and cook until golden brown.
- Serve warm with your favorite toppings.
